package org.pentaho.platform.api.engine;
import java.util.regex.Matcher;
public interface IParameterResolver {
/**
* Provides a way for components to inject their own replacements of parameter markers in the provided template.
* This currently exposes too much of the internals of TemplateUtil IMO, but without serious surgery on the
* TemplateUtil, this is about the only way to accomplish the task.
*
* @param template
* The string containing replacement parameters
* @param parameterName
* The name of the located parameter in the template
* @param parameterMatcher
* The Regex matcher that located the parameter
* @param copyStart
* The current start to copy from the template
* @param result
* The final string with the parameter replacements inlined
* @return integer indicating the new copyStart to be used in the TemplateUtil in the event that the component
* handled the parameter. If negative, then no processing was done in the component. Any value greater
* than or equal to zero indicates processing happened in the component.
*
* TODO: Change this interface to make it easier to do things without exposing the internals of
* TemplateUtil.
*/
public int resolveParameter( String template, String parameterName, Matcher parameterMatcher, int copyStart,
StringBuffer result );
}
